Consolidated Communications Holdings, Inc. (CNSL) has seen some recent volatility in the marketplace and its common shares were last quoted at $5.88 yesterday. Traders are starting to take notice of CNSL as the common shares traded as high as $5.94 and as low as $5.83 in the previous trading session.

Consolidated Communications Holdings, Inc. (CNSL) average trading volume is 458.30K. However, in the previous trading session Consolidated Communications Holdings, Inc. (CNSL) traded 276,055 shares. The 1st support level on CNSL is $5.57 and the 1st resistance level on CNSL is $8.55. CNSL 50 day moving average is $6.63 and CNSL 200-day moving average is $6.33.

Consolidated Communications Holdings, Inc. (CNSL) recent performance has been specified by the recent movement in CNSL common shares. CNSL has performed -16.54% over the past month, CNSL has performed -3.37% over the past quarter and CNSL has shown 75.00% over the past 365 days. Consolidated Communications Holdings, Inc. (CNSL) has a 12 month range of $3.24 to $8.81. Consolidated Communications Holdings, Inc. (CNSL) is trading 81.48% from its 12 month low and -33.26% from its 12 month high. Consolidated Communications Holdings, Inc. (CNSL) is displaying a 9.65% short float displaying the quantity short in the float.

CNSL has 79.41M shares outstanding and 71.65M shares in the float. Consolidated Communications Holdings, Inc. (CNSL) presently has a market cap of $423.71M and income of 23.00M. The EPS next quarter for CNSL is 0.17 and anticipated EPS next year is -22.08%. The market cap of Consolidated Communications Holdings, Inc. (CNSL) at $423.71M represents how many Traders own shares of CNSL and is based off the last price ($5.88) of CNSL and the quantity of shares outstanding (79.41M) with Consolidated Communications Holdings, Inc. (CNSL).

Consolidated Communications Holdings, Inc. (CNSL) has aggregate cash (mrq) of 45.88M, aggregate cash per share (mrq) of 0.63, aggregate debt of CNSL stands at 2.26B and aggregate debt/equity (mrq) is 607.47. . Consolidated Communications Holdings, Inc. (CNSL) operating cash flow (ttm) is 357.56M, CNSL leveraged free cash flow (ttm) is 148.67M.

CNSL is trading -0.41% below (bearish) its SMA20, -16.36% below (bearish) its SMA50 and -0.75% below (bearish) its SMA200.